What they do
A Janitor or Cleaner provides cleaning and basic maintenance in buildings such as schools, offices, stores, hospitals or hotels. Cleans and polishes floors, removes trash, vacuums carpets, washes windows, cleans bathrooms, stocks building supplies such as light bulbs and paper towels and performs minor repairs as needed. Holds keys for rooms and building entrances and locks or unlocks them as needed.

Job Description
Custodial Services at the University of Tennessee at Martin is currently accepting applications for an assistant custodial foreman. The normal work schedule is Monday through Friday, 3:00 PM - 11:00 PM, but shift subject to change (40 hours per week). This is a full-time position with benefits.
Minimum Qualifications:
- High school diploma and six months of relevant experience, or an equivalent combination of education, training, and experience.
- Experience and knowledge of custodial equipment, to include operation and safety.
- Experience and knowledge in the use and safety of cleaning chemicals.
- Must be able to follow written and oral instructions.
- Must be able to read, write, and communicate effectively; able to interact positively with co-workers.
- Physical condition conducive to performance of labor tasks (this includes bending, reaching overhead, lifting as much as 50 pounds, stooping, climbing ladders to height of twenty feet, operating power washer, buffers, vacuums, shampoo machines and scrubbers).
- Must have good work and attendance record.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Supervisory experience in the custodial field for two or more years is preferred.
